		<description><![CDATA[It's a movie about a couple of different stories that have nothing to do with each other. Thank God. I am really starting to hate those 'life is all interconnected' type movies (think Crash, Powder Blue). However, it's that annoying hand held camera type film (Blair Witch, Cloverfield). I can tolerate these, but I know lots of people hate them.

There is a decent amount of gore, but it isn't excessive. The scariest parts of the movie are not the blood and guts. Again, I can tolerate blood and guts, but it doesn't make a movie for me. Suspense and intrigue does, so good job on that with this one.]]></description>
